Finite Element Analysis of Overall Hydraulic Support Based on ANSYS

Abstract
Based on the parameters of the hydraulic support in a mine.The 3D model with the Pro/E software is set up.And then according to the actual needs of the working conditions underground production,the use of ANSYS Workbench finite element analysis on the machine to determine the condition of stress,strain and displacement changes.
